The Wild Hunt: Conjunction

[Part of the Wild Hunt story]

With Radovid out of the way, Nilfgaard turned its attention directly to Skellige. Among their massive armada sailed Geralt and company, with an Emperor approved plan to lure the Wild Hunt into battle for one final confrontation.

As Avallac'h expected, they took the magical bait and arrived right into the prison dome maintained by the lodge sorceresses where Geralt, Ciri, and the Nilfgaard army ambushed them. Not one to sit out of a fight, the Skellige fleet also arrived with Crach and Hjalmar at the helm.

None could match the King of the Hunt though, with even Crach falling victim to his blade. Unfortunately for him, the White Wolf's reflexes were better than his magic and the witcher avenged his fallen friend with style.

His death did not end the threats though, as their arrival had begun another Conjuction of Spheres - where the gateway to other worlds opened to let numerous creatures teleport in. The worst of these was the White Frost, a world killing magical storm who prophecy claimed could only be defeated by a child of the elder blood. Ciri.

Having been trained by Avallac'h for exactly this purpose, Ciri stepped through a gateway to face this unstoppable threat... and won.

The Wild Hunt: Bears

[Part of the Wild Hunt story]

While the feast starts off as a normal rambunctious affair it quickly sours when a number of guests suddenly shift into bears and slaughter all but three candidates for the crown before Geralt can put them down.

Hjalmar immediately decides to hunt down the bear related clansmen but the witcher opts to stay and assist Cerys in actually investigating the crime scene, discovering that those that transformed were actually poisoned to do so by the mother of the third contender and son of the previous King.

The guilty party is arrested and for her intellect Cerys is voted the first ever Queen of Skellige. During the coronation celebration, the witcher unexpectedly finds another trail to follow on his hunt for Ciri. That of a hideous man creature he and Yen previously heard about.

One of the Jarl's actually knew of such a monster, having sold the misshapen tyke to the Continent to a trader who worked for the Bloody Baron.

The Wild Hunt: Djinn

[Part of the Wild Hunt story]

Geralt found sharing the small skiff with Yen to be quite pleasant. Just the two of them, sailing out in the middle of nowhere. It wasn't without purpose however, for Yennefer did have a destination in mind - a shipwreck that she deduced was the home of a djinn.

After a difficult battle, the pair managed to capture the air spirit with Yen making but one wish before letting it go: To undo Geralt's last wish made with a previous djinn, a wish that the two of them would always be together.

The creature accepted before flying off, leaving the two wondering why their feelings for each other remained despite having their magical link removed. It doesn't take long for them to realize that the magic of true love is much stronger than any wish, and they share a kiss while watching the sun rise.
